  • Patent number: 6785060
    Abstract: A reflecting-type optical system according to the invention includes an optical element composed of a transparent body having an entrance surface, an exit surface and at least three curved reflecting surfaces of internal reflection. A light beam coming from an object and entering at the entrance surface is reflected from at least one of the reflecting surfaces to form a primary image within the optical element and is, then, made to exit from the exit surface through the remaining reflecting surfaces to form an object image on a predetermined plane. In the optical system, 70% or more of the length of a reference axis in the optical element lies in one plane.

  • Patent number: 6498624
    Abstract: There is provided an optical apparatus which has excellent assembly performance, can suppress an increase in cost, and attain a decrease in thickness. The optical apparatus includes a board (1) having a photographing optical system and a mechanical system mounted on its surface. A plurality of opening portions (1a, 1b, 1c) are formed in the board (1). The opening portion (1a) is sealed with a sealing member such as a glass member to allow a light beam to pass and prevent dust and the like from entering the storage space for parts between the board (1) and a shield case (49). The photographing optical system mounted on the board (1) includes a stop unit (30) for adjusting the light amount of an object image guided through the opening portion (1a), and prism-like optical members (G1, G2, G3, G4), each consisting of, e.g., a glass or plastic material and having a sculptured surface as a reflecting surface.

  • Patent number: 6457647
    Abstract: A memory card adaptor comprising an adaptor main body detachably insertable in a memory card slot of a piece of information equipment; a first connector based on standard specifications, provided on the adaptor main body and adapted to be connected to a connector provided in the memory card slot; a mounting portion provided on the adaptor main body and adapted to detachably receive a memory card which is detachably inserted into a memory card slot of another piece of equipment different from the information equipment, for effecting exchange of information signals in serial data form with the external equipment; and a second connector not based on the standard specifications, provided on the mounting portion and adapted to be connected with a connector provided on the memory card and corresponding to a connector in the memory card slot of the external equipment; wherein exchange of information signals in serial data form is enabled between the information equipment and the memory card by insertion of the adapt

  • Patent number: 5351139
    Abstract: There is disclosed an apparatus including a guide member for guiding a photographed film, an illumination unit for illuminating the film, a reflection member for reflecting light from the film, a conversion unit for photoelectrically converting light reflected by the reflection member, and a housing which builds in at least the conversion unit and the illumination unit.
